Jake Paul's fight with Tommy Fury will take place on February 25

Boxer and blogger Jake Paul's fight with Tommy Fury, brother of world heavyweight champion Tyson Fury, will take place on February 25. The match will be held in Saudi Arabia.

The fight was planned to be held several years in a row. However, for the first time, Tommy withdrew from the match due to health problems that affected his training camp.

The fight was then scheduled to take place in August in New York, but again fell through due to Fury's US visa issues. Paul wanted to replace Tommy with Hashim Rahman Jr. at short notice, but the son of the ex-world heavyweight champion couldn't fit into the regulated 200-pound limit.

Paul had his last fight with Brazilian Anderson Silva on October 29. The American won the eight-round fight by unanimous decision of the judges.

23-year-old Tommy Fury had his last professional fight in April of last year, defeating Daniel Bocianski. In November, Fury took part in an exhibition fight with Rollie Lambert on the undercard of Floyd Mayweather's fight with blogger Deji.
